About Adrienne

Adrienne has 18 years of experience working in health care supporting others through times of illness, injury, grief, and transition. With that foundation in nursing, she is now earning her masters in counselling psychology and in practicum at Impart Therapy. She works with adults using an approach grounded in learning to pay attention to the present moment and to be kind to oneself. She connects with clients creatively and flexibly, always looking to leverage her client’s strengths. Not taking the same approach to each client, she tailors the process to her client’s needs and goals. She wants you to know that you have been seen and heard. A lifelong learner, Adrienne loves to share what she is delving into with her clients when relevant. Her lived experience as a late-diagnosed ADHD woman was typical. Like many other women, her diagnosis followed previous ones of anxiety and depression. Because of that, she is enthusiastic about providing safe non-judgmental spaces for neurodivergent folks. Adrienne meets clients where they are on their journey. Whether the issue is new or ongoing, she recognizes that reaching out can feel like a big step. She hopes to make that process a little less overwhelming and a lot more manageable one step at a time.
